1<h2>do_mach_notify_send_once</h2>
2<hr>
3<p>
4<strong>Server Interface</strong> - Handle the current instance of a send-once notification.
5<h3>SYNOPSIS</h3>
6<pre>
7<strong>kern_return_t   do_mach_notify_send_once</strong>
8                <strong>(notify_port_t</strong>                          <var>notify</var><strong>)</strong>
9
10
11<strong>kern_return_t   do_seqnos_mach_notify_send_once</strong>
12                <strong>(notify_port_t</strong>                           <var>notify</var>,
13                 <strong>mach_port_seqno_t</strong>                        <var>seqno</var><strong>);</strong>
14</pre>
15<h3>PARAMETERS</h3>
16<dl>
17<p>
18<dt> <var>notify</var> 
19<dd>
20[in notify (receive) right]
21The port to which the notification was sent.
22<p>
23<dt> <var>seqno</var> 
24<dd>
25[in scalar]
26The sequence number of this message relative to the
27notification port.
28</dl>
29<h3>DESCRIPTION</h3>
30<p>
31A <strong>do_mach_notify_send_once</strong> function is called by <strong>notify_server</strong>
32as the result 
33of a kernel message indicating that a send-once right was in
34any way destroyed. 
35<var>notify</var> is the port for which a send-once right was destroyed.
36<h3>RETURN VALUES</h3>
37<p>
38Only generic errors apply.
